"Delhi Crime" Season 2: A Masterclass in Police Procedurals
First up, we absolutely have to talk about "Delhi Crime" Season 2. If you watched the first season, you already know how incredible this show is. And guess what? The second season delivered! This series is a gripping, true-crime-inspired drama that delves deep into the complexities of policing in Delhi. It's a masterclass in tension-building, character development, and realistic portrayal of investigations. The new Indian series on Netflix in 2022 truly shone with this installment, focusing on a new set of chilling crimes and the relentless pursuit of justice by DCP Vartika Chaturvedi and her team. What makes "Delhi Crime" so compelling is its raw authenticity. It doesn't shy away from the gritty realities of crime and policing, presenting a nuanced look at societal issues, the pressures faced by law enforcement, and the impact of crime on victims and their families. The performances are outstanding, particularly Shefali Shah as DCP Chaturvedi, who brings a powerful blend of strength, empathy, and determination to the role. The writing is sharp, the pacing is impeccable, and the direction ensures that every episode is a tight, suspenseful ride. It’s more than just a crime procedural; it’s a human drama that explores themes of class, caste, and the societal factors that contribute to crime. "Panchayat" Season 2: Heartwarming Rural Comedy-Drama
Next on our list of must-watch new Indian series on Netflix in 2022 is the delightful "Panchayat" Season 2. Oh man, this show is like a warm hug! If you're looking for something that's lighthearted yet deeply meaningful, this is it. The series follows Abhishek Tripathi, a city-bred engineering graduate who, due to a lack of better job options, becomes a Panchayat secretary in a remote village called Phulera. The beauty of "Panchayat" lies in its simplicity and its incredibly relatable characters. It captures the essence of rural Indian life with such charm and humor, exploring the everyday challenges, relationships, and the slow, gradual changes that happen in such communities. The second season continues Abhishek's journey as he navigates his life in Phulera, his evolving relationships with the villagers, especially the pragmatic Pradhan Ji, the resourceful Prahlad, and the ever-enthusiastic Manju Devi. The comedic timing is spot-on, often arising from the cultural clashes between Abhishek's urban sensibilities and the village's traditional ways. But beneath the laughs, there's a profound sense of warmth and humanity. It beautifully portrays the importance of community, the dignity of labor, and finding joy in simple things. The performances are stellar, with Jitendra Kumar as Abhishek leading a cast that feels like family. "Mai: The Girl Who Knew Too Much": A Mother's Revenge Saga
Another compelling addition to the new Indian series on Netflix in 2022 is "Mai: The Girl Who Knew Too Much." This series offers a gripping revenge saga with a powerful female lead. It centers around Sheel Chaudhary, an ordinary homemaker who is thrust into a world of crime and violence after her daughter's mysterious death. What begins as a quest for answers quickly escalates into a full-blown mission for vengeance. Sakshi Tanwar delivers a phenomenal performance as Sheel, portraying her transformation from a grieving mother to a determined force of nature. The series is expertly crafted, blending suspense, action, and emotional depth. It explores themes of motherhood, betrayal, and the lengths one would go to for justice.
